WebSep 21, 2024 · In the second to last game, on September 30, 1927, Babe Ruth hit his 60th home run. The crowd cheered wildly. Fans threw their hats in the air and confetti rained down on the field. Babe Ruth, a man known around the world as one of the greatest baseball players of all time, had done the impossible—hit 60 home runs in one season. WebApr 12, 2024 · Ruth’s Career Highlights. Babe Ruth began his professional baseball career in 1914 with the Boston Red Sox. He quickly became one of the most feared hitters in the game, setting numerous records for home runs and batting average.
